hyssop loosestrife vs Kaba aklarotu
Lythrum hyssopifolia compared with Lythrum thymifolia
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| hyssop loosestrife | Kaba aklarotu |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(bitki) | Plantae (bitki)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class same |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order same | Myrtales (Myrtales) | Myrtales (Myrtales) |
| Family same | Lythraceae | Lythraceae |
| Genus same | Lythrum | Lythrum |
| Species | Lythrum hyssopifolia | Lythrum thymifolia |
Evolutionary Relationship
hyssop loosestrife and Kaba aklarotu share a common ancestor at the Genus level: Lythrum.

Habitat & Geographic Range
hyssop loosestrife
Typically found in diverse terrestrial habitats from tropical forests to temperate regions.
Widely distributed across Africa (South Africa), Asia (Japan), Europe (11 countries), North America (Canada, United States), and South America (Brazil, Chile, Ecuador).
Kaba aklarotu
Typically found in diverse terrestrial habitats from tropical forests to temperate regions.
Distributed across Bulgaria, Croatia, Portugal, Sweden, and United States.
